Understanding the Basics of Fish Finders

Although fish finders might appear complicated initially, knowing their core components and features is crucial for unlocking their full potential. At their foundation, a fish finder is made up of a transducer, that sends sonar waves beneath the water's surface, and a display unit that interprets the returning signals. The transducer sends out sound waves that bounce off objects underwater, including fish, structure, and the seabed.

The signals travel back to the transducer, providing data that is displayed visually on the screen. This enables fishermen to determine fish positions, depth, and subsurface structures. The precision of this data relies on elements such as the sonar wave frequency and the caliber of the equipment. How to Optimize Your Fish Finder Settings

Adjusting sonar device settings can significantly improve an fisherman's ability to find fish and submerged structures. To achieve this, anglers should begin by adjusting the sensitivity. Increased sensitivity can reveal more details, while lower sensitivity minimizes interference. Additionally, the frequency setting is essential; higher frequencies deliver superior detail in shallow water, whereas lower frequencies cover greater depths.

Modifying the transducer cone angle also plays a considerable role. A wider cone angle allows for a broader view, but might reduce precision, while a smaller angle delivers accuracy in particular regions.

Additionally, toggling between screen modes, such as bottom imaging or side-scan imaging, can assist in visualizing aquatic environments with improved clarity. As a final step, consistently calibrating the fishfinder maintains top performance. By precisely adjusting these settings, anglers can significantly enhance their ability to locate fish and enhancing their overall fishing experience.

Exploring Sonar Technology

As anglers explore the world of fish finders, mastering the fundamentals of sonar technology is crucial for successful fishing trips. Sonar, which stands for Sound Navigation and Ranging, utilizes sound waves to detect objects underwater. Fish-finding devices produce sound pulses that travel through water, bouncing back from objects like fish, rocks, and the seabed. The device then processes these echoes, presenting them as visual data on a screen. Understanding the difference between standard 2D sonar and advanced CHIRP (Compressed High-Intensity Radiated Pulse) can improve an angler's skill in locating fish more effectively. By analyzing the depth, size, and density of these echoes, anglers can more effectively plan their fishing efforts, leading to a more productive experience on the water.

Indicators of Reading Depth

Understanding fish icons on a fish finder provides a strong foundation for reading depth indicators. These readings display the subsurface landscape and water column, essential for finding fish. Depth readings generally display in standard measurements, enabling anglers to assess how deep they are working. A uniform depth can indicate suitable fishing grounds, while abrupt shifts may indicate underwater structures, such as ledges or underwater formations, that draw in fish. Anglers should also be aware of the brightness and depth of the signals; stronger color signals often indicate heavier masses, like groups of fish. Identifying these patterns enables anglers to plan effectively about the best casting locations, improving their likelihood of catching fish.

Finding Hotspots With Your Fish Finder

Whereas numerous anglers trust their instincts and experience to discover fish, using a fish finder can significantly improve their capacity to pinpoint productive spots. A fish finder utilizes sonar technology to locate underwater formations, fish clusters, and fluctuations in water depth, making it an essential device for identifying highly productive fishing zones.

To efficiently identify prime fishing spots, anglers should pay attention to features such as drop-offs, submerged rocks, and vegetation, which frequently draw fish in. The sonar display will reveal these structural elements, enabling anglers to direct their attention where fish are most likely to gather.

Moreover, observing water conditions such as temperature and clarity can improve the identification of hotspots. Different species prefer specific conditions, and a fish finder can uncover these nuances.
